TRIBUTES have been left on a road side where a young man has been killed in a motorbike crash on the A449 near Worcester.
The man in his 20s was found dead on a grass verge next to a damaged bike on Saturday morning.
Sergeant Glenn Jones said: “Police were called at around 8.15am on Saturday 12 October to reports of an RTC involving a motorbike on the A449 at Worcester between the Six Ways roundabout and the Blackpole exit."
“When officers arrived they discovered a person on the grass verge and a damaged motorcycle nearby. Officers were able to determine that the victim, a man in his 20s had sadly died. The man’s next of kin have been informed."
“An investigation is underway and I would ask the public if they have any information, dash cam footage or witnessed the incident which may have happened between 8pm on Friday 11 October and 8am on Saturday 12 October to please get in touch by calling 101 and quoting incident number 175s of the 12 October 2019.”
